    Summary: 
    When Thalia, Kalliope, and Charis set off to regency London for their first Season, they know excatly what they want. Thalia means to make her mark among the intelligentsia and publish her poetry, perhaps even be a little irresponsible. Her sister Kalli aims to take high society by storm, with parties and gowns galore and a proper husband at the end of it all. Their cousin Charis hopes to earn her place among the (nearly exclusive male) scientific elite -- and has no interest in the social scene whatsoever. Though their goals may be different, at least they'll all be debuting in society together. But the best-laid plans of Regency ladies tend to go awry, and this Season, it doesn't take long for things to fall apart. Kalli finds herself embroiled in scandal and reliant upon an arranged marriage to redeem her reputation, Thalia's dreams of becoming a great poet are threatened by her attraction to a charming rake, and Charis finds herself an expected social hit -- and the source of a scientific dilemma that her heart might not survive. Can these young women find their happily ever afters in this turbulent London Season?
    In 1817 England, teenagers Thalia, Charis, and Kallie navigate a London Season gone awry.
